WHAT'S NEW FOR 2009

The first Jeep vehicle with three rows of seats to carry seven passengers now features an available 5.7-Liter HEMI engine capable of 357 horsepower (266 kW) and 389 lb.-ft. (527 N*m) of torque. 2009 Jeep Commander customers now can visit more places and enjoy their "go-anywhere, do-anything" lifestyles with a HEMI under the hood, and they'll enjoy better fuel economy, too.

EXTERIOR

* HID headlamps with auto-leveling feature (Optional on Limited models, standard on Overland models)
* Body-color exterior mirrors (Standard on Limited models)
* Rain-sensing wipers (Optional on Sport models equipped with the U package)

INTERIOR

* Leather-trimmed front seats with map pocket (Passenger side on Limited models and both sides on Overland models)
* Instrument panel upgrades to include Tire Pressure Monitoring System
* uconnect gps with iPod interface
* New 9-inch rear DVD screen replaces 8-inch screen

POWERTRAIN/CHASSIS

* New 5.7-liter HEMI engine
* 17-inch aluminum machined-face wheels with painted pockets (Standard on Sport models)
* 17-inch, five-spoke aluminum machined face wheels with painted pockets (Standard on Limited models, optional on Overland models)
* 18-inch, seven-spoke aluminum chrome-clad wheels (Standard on Overland models)
